In this episode, we chat to Phil Day, CEO of Scotgold, a junior mining company that is Scotland's first gold producer. They are growing their company with further exploration activities in and around the Scottish Highlands. Phil is a highly experienced senior mining executive with a career spanning over 25 years. He has a background in metallurgy and chemistry and has many senior appointments in his career in Africa and the US before taking the helm at Scotgold and talks to us about Scotland's first gold mine and what it means to the area and the Scottish people. KEY TAKEAWAYS The geology of the Cononish Mine, in Scotland, is the best Phil has seen throughout his career. Lead was first mined in Cononish in the 1700s. The quartz vein was found in the 1980s, then gold. Gold production started in 2020. Gold is being found in places they were not expecting, in the mine. They are operating in a National Park. Phil explains how they are handling this. In particular what they are doing with the tailings. They are predicting an EBIT Da of about 21 to 24 million. The plan is to take the company into the million-tonne area, by running an exploration programme. They produce a concentrate, as well as gravity gold. So, they will be able to make Scottish gold coins, bars and jewellery.
